FM Exam Structure: Explained Simply
FM is a computer-based exam with both objective and written-style questions.
Exam Format
| Section | Type of Questions | Marks |
| A | Objective questions (MCQs) | 30 |
| B | Objective case questions | 30 |
| C | Long calculation & discussion questions | 40 |
| Total | 100 |
Passing marks: 50
Section C is the most important because it carries 40 marks and tests your understanding deeply.

Major FM Topics: Explained in Easy Language
1. Financial Management Function
This topic explains:
- Role of a finance manager
- Objectives of financial management
- Shareholder wealth maximisation
You must understand why businesses aim to increase value, not just profit.
Important Questions (2026):
- What is shareholder wealth maximisation?
- Role of financial manager
- Difference between profit and value
2. Working Capital Management (Very High Priority)
This is one of the most tested topics in FM.
You study:
- Cash management
- Inventory control
- Receivables and payables
This topic is very practical and scoring.
Important Questions (2026):
- Meaning of working capital
- Cash operating cycle
- Inventory management techniques
- Receivables management
- Payables management
3. Investment Appraisal (Core FM Area)
This topic helps you decide:
- Which project is worth investing in
You learn methods like:
- Payback
- Net Present Value (NPV)
- Internal Rate of Return (IRR)
This area is almost guaranteed in Section C.
Important Questions (2026 – Must Prepare):
- NPV calculation and decision
- Advantages of NPV
- Payback vs NPV
- IRR problems and interpretation
- Non-financial factors in investment decisions
4. Cost of Capital
This topic explains:
- Cost of debt
- Cost of equity
- Weighted Average Cost of Capital (WACC)
It shows how expensive financing can be.
Important Questions (2026):
- Cost of debt calculation
- Cost of equity
- WACC calculation
- Importance of WACC
5. Business Finance
This topic covers:
- Sources of finance
- Short-term and long-term finance
- Islamic vs conventional finance (basic understanding)
Important Questions (2026)
- Internal vs external finance
- Equity vs debt
- Advantages and disadvantages of financing sources
6. Risk and Return
This topic explains:
- Business risk
- Financial risk
- Relationship between risk and return
Conceptual clarity is very important here.
Important Questions (2026):
- Meaning of risk
- Types of risk
- Risk vs return relationship
7. Business Valuation (Medium Priority)
You learn:
- How to value shares
- Dividend valuation models
Important Questions:
- Dividend growth model
- Factors affecting share value
FM Section C: How to Score Maximum Marks
Section C questions usually come from:
- Investment appraisal
- Working capital
- Cost of capital
To score well:
- Show clear workings
- Explain decisions in simple sentences
- Do not leave questions blank
Even partial answers give marks.
